Stuart had spent years    communicating with cousins across the country she had never    met. They discovered as adults they share a DNA match, and    their relationships solidified through a mutual love of family    history and countless phone calls, emails and Facebook posts.  <\/p>\n<p>    So last month, Stuart opened her home to six of her distant    cousins so they could get to know more about each other and    their shared history.  <\/p>\n<p>    Extended family  <\/p>\n<p>    Stuart, 65, moved to Charlotte from New York in 2010. A retired    clinical laboratory technologist Stuart became interested in    her genealogy back in the 80s and is her familys historian.  <\/p>\n<p>    In 2010, she had a DNA test done to see whether there were any    family members she didnt know. The first test was through the    National Geographic Genographic Project. But it was through    Family Tree DNA that Stuart found a match. She had sent in a    cheek swab for the mtDNA test, which uses mitochondrial DNA to    find genetic cousins along the direct maternal line.  <\/p>\n<p>    The match was the Rev. Dan W. Tullis Sr., who lived in    California and had DNA on his mothers side that matched    Stuarts. She sent an email to establish contact and got a    reply from his daughter, Dwainia, that Tullis had died in 2009.  <\/p>\n<p>    Stuart and Dwainia Tullis, 57, shared an interest in family    history and began communicating regularly. Dwainia Tullis had    also done a DNA test through the Genographic Project and gotten    her results in 2006. The results had already led her to another    cousin, Sara McNary, 48, in Atlanta, and cousin Sylvia    Payne-Goodner, 62, in Franklin, Ky. While they dont know how    closely they are related, Stuart said, their DNA all matches to    Dan Tullis.  <\/p>\n<p>    For the past three years these four family historians have    stayed in contact.
